Microlife BP A2 Classic Digital Blood Pressure Monitor is a high-precision, easy-to-use device designed for accurate and reliable blood pressure measurements. It features Microlife's patented Gentle+ technology, ensuring a comfortable experience during cuff inflation and deflation. The device is fully automatic, providing systolic, diastolic, and pulse rate readings with a simple one-touch operation. Its large, backlit display offers clear visibility, making it ideal for users of all ages, including seniors. The Microlife BP A2 Classic is equipped with a memory function that can store up to 30 readings, allowing for long-term tracking of blood pressure levels. Additionally, the monitor includes an irregular heartbeat detection (IHB) feature, alerting users to potential arrhythmias.
